Also dw too much about accommodation near the campus – unlike say Lboro or Warwick, Bristol is not a campus uni (this has been disputed by MN posters before but the geography of the city is the same as it was 40 years ago!). The uni sprawls, as indeed the city does. You can be in halls in Clifton (Goldney for example) and have a 20-min walk to the uni library or your department. Some of the halls are over the Downs in Stoke Bishop, some are in the city centre. The dental school is in the city centre, the railway station is a bit further than that. It's fine. Get a bike or get ready to walk up lots of hills.
